Title :
Effect of smooth non-linear distortion on OFDM BER
Author :
Van den Bos, Chris ; Kouwenhoven, Michiel H L ; Serdijn, Wouter A.
Author_Institution :
Fac. of Inf. Technol. & Syst., Delft Univ. of Technol., Netherlands
Abstract :
Non-linear distortion of OFDM signals can significantly increase the receiver BER. Currently, distortion analyses rely on simulation, not yielding insight into the problem, or apply to specific non-linearities only. In this paper, general analytic results are presented on the errors resulting from distortion. The results are applicable to smooth non-linear distortion of an OFDM signal, which is the most common distortion. Simple analytical expressions are derived which allows a designer to determine the BER before performing simulations. Further, it is shown that the error on each OFDM subcarrier is approximately equally large
